Abstract: We prove that Vertex Reinforced Random Walk on mathbbZ with weight of order kalpha, with alphain[0,1/2), is either almost surely recurrent or almost surely transient. This improves a previous result of Volkov who showed that the set of sites which are visited infinitely often was a.s. either empty or infinite.
